Understanding Heat Exchange Technology
Heat exchange espresso machines run on an unique concept that allows synchronised water heating for developing and steaming. Home Espresso Machines are equipped with a single boiler that utilizes a heat exchanger system. This function is significant as it enables users to brew espresso while steaming milk simultaneously, promoting efficiency in the coffee-making process.
How Does a Heat Exchange Espresso Machine Work?
The procedure starts with the machine's water inlet filling the boiler. As the water warms up, it turns to steam. The ingenious heat exchanger uses hot steam to heat extra water in a separate passage created specifically for the brew group. This suggests that water can reach the ideal developing temperature level without waiting for the boiler to change. The key steps include:
- Water Fill: Water is drawn into the boiler.
- Heating Process: The boiler warms up as water is converted into steam.
- Heat Exchange: Steam heats water in the heat exchanger tube.
- Developing: Water from the heat exchanger is pressed through coffee premises, drawing out the flavors required for an abundant espresso.
This procedure enables quick temperature level changes and improved coffee extraction.
Advantages of Heat Exchange Espresso Machines
Heat exchange espresso machines provide several benefits, particularly for those looking to optimize their coffee experience. Here are some essential benefits:
- Simultaneous Brewing and Steaming: Users can brew espresso while steaming milk, making it ideal for hectic cafes and home baristas who value performance.
- Temperature Stability: The boiler's steam pressure helps keep a steady temperature, which is critical for constant espresso extraction.
- Adaptability: The style allows for quick switching in between brewing and steaming, making it much easier to produce numerous coffee beverages, from lattes to coffees.
- User-friendly: Models typically include accessible controls, making it feasible for both newbies and knowledgeable baristas to produce quality drinks.
- Professional Quality: Heat exchange machines are often utilized in commercial settings, supplying users with high-quality brewing performance in the house.
Secret Features to Look for in Heat Exchange Espresso Machines
When thinking about the purchase of a heat exchange espresso machine, there are several functions that one need to take into account:
- Build Quality: Look for machines made from resilient materials, such as stainless-steel or brass, ensuring durability.
- Boiler Size: A larger boiler will hold more water and sustain higher output with time.
- PID Temperature Control: This feature helps preserve constant brew temperature levels, which can improve the coffee-making procedure.
- Group Head Design: Machines with a saturated or semi-saturated group head provide better temperature level stability.
- Alleviate of Use: User-friendly user interfaces and instinctive controls boost the total experience for baristas at all ability levels.
- Steam Wand Quality: A good steam wand with correct insulation and flexibility enables much better texturing of milk.
- Water Reservoir Size: Depending on your requirements, think about how typically you want to fill up the water reservoir.

Frequently Asked Questions About Heat Exchange Espresso Machines
What is the main distinction in between a heat exchange and a dual boiler espresso machine?
While both types can brew espresso and steam milk at the very same time, dual boiler machines have different boilers for developing and steaming. In contrast, heat exchange machines make use of a single boiler and a heat exchanger to attain the very same function.
Are heat exchange machines appropriate for novices?
Yes! Lots of heat exchange machines are created with user-friendly features, making them accessible for newbies. With proper assistance and practice, users can rapidly produce quality espresso.
What kind of upkeep do heat exchange espresso machines require?
Regular upkeep includes descaling, cleaning the boiler, checking seals and gaskets, and keeping the group head clean. Routine upkeep makes sure longevity and constant performance.
